装VS2010学习版前,先把这三个坑填了
盯着屏幕上弹出的“安装失败”红叉,你是不是也想过直接把电脑砸了?别急,我替你把vs2010学习版安装路上的三个大坑填平了。
先别急着重装系统,这几个常见报错我替你查了
很多朋友在安装vs2010学习版时遇到版本不兼容的提示,其实是因为Windows 10或更高版本需要安装额外的补丁,而这个补丁在微软官网上已经被隐藏了,需要手动搜索KB971092或KB976098才能找到。我遇到过一位用户,他反复重装了五次系统,最后发现只是差了一个补丁。另一个常见问题是安装进度卡在“正在配置组件”那里一动不动,这多半是杀毒软件拦截了注册表写入动作。关掉实时防护再试一次,就能继续走下去。还有一个更隐蔽的坑:下载的安装包明明是官方文件,但双击后提示“此程序可能不兼容”。这时别信系统提示,右键选择“以管理员身份运行”,往往就能顺利启动。
别怕。试试上面这三招。
下载源怎么选?官方闭源和第三方镜像的区别
找不到vs2010学习版下载地址是另一个高频痛点。微软从2019年起就移除了所有Visual Studio 2010的官方公开链接,但并没有删除服务器上的文件。你可以在MSDN我告诉你这个第三方镜像站里找到 VS2010_Express_CN.iso 文件,MD5值记得比对一下。有些网盘里的压缩包动不动就让付费解压,或者捆绑了流氓软件——手一碰就自动装全家桶。如果你坚持用官方下载器,可以试着在URL后直接拼接 /downloads/release/... 这类路径,但成功率不如直接用ISO文件高。下载完成后,建议先用哈希校验工具核对一下,防止文件损坏导致安装到一半报错。
就这一招。
最后提醒一句:安装成功不代表万事大吉。vs2010学习版默认不支持C++11标准,写代码时如果遇到莫名其妙的语法错误,考虑升级到更高版本或者安装Visual Studio Community 2022。如果只是学C语言基础,这玩意儿够你折腾半年。问题解决了就去泡杯茶,别在这耗着。




